I create my own classes for this. (Essentially to do the same thing as sklearn pipelines, but I like creating my own classes just for this debugging/slowly expand functionality reason.) Something like:
class mymodel(): ... def feature_engineering(self): ... def impute_missing(self): ... def fit(self) ... def predict_proba(self) ...
Then it is pretty trivial to test with new data. And you can parameterize the things you want, e.g. init fit method as random forest or xgboost, or stack on different feature engineering, etc. And for debugging you can extract/step through the individual methods.
